Castelli Estremo Gloves

(0)
USD 49.00 USD 89.99 -46%
Brand: Castelli
Product Code: CS810932
Stock Instock
Viewed 1326 times

OverView

Castelli Estremo Gloves

Castelli Estremo Gloves are a type of cyclin...

Available Options